Slow Cooker Apple Butter
Ingredients
- 4 pounds cooking apples, peeled and sliced
- 1/2 cup apple cider vinegar
- 3 cups sugar
- 1 cup firmly packed brown sugar
- 1 teaspoon ground nutmeg
Preparation
- Place sliced apple and vinegar in a 4-quart slow cooker.
- Cook, covered, at HIGH 6 hours. Stir in sugars and nutmeg. Reduce setting to LOW; cook, covered, 4 hours. Cool. Store in refrigerator up to 1 week.
